  1. Click ‘Get Form’ to open the Alaska Report Guardianship in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ering the name of the minor and their date of birth in the designated fields. Ensure accuracy as this information is crucial for identification.
  3. Fill out the guardian's information, including name, daytime phone number, and mailing address. If your mailing address has changed, check the appropriate box.
  4. In the 'Information About Minor' section, provide details about the minor's housing situation, medical care received in the past year, and educational status. Be thorough to give a complete picture.
  5. Complete sections regarding any significant events affecting the minor and their income/assets. This includes detailing any trusts or pending lawsuits involving the minor.
  6. Finally, ensure you sign under oath in front of a notary public or court clerk before submitting your report.

There may be an unnecessary infringement of the alleged incapacitated persons privacy, freedom and loss of decision-making authority. The appointed guardian may over time become overly protective, dominating and arbitrary.
There are legal forms to do this. You may do this on a temporary basis with a legal document called Guardianship or permanently. I would see a lawyer to help you with this and if you cannot afford one, go to legal aid in your county. You do not have to go to court.
Heres a list of five specific types of guardianship court evidence that could be necessary for such cases: Document 1: Medical Reports/Evaluations. Document 2: Letters of Recommendation. Document 3: Background Check/Criminal Record. Document 4: Financial Statements. Document 5: Previous Guardianship/Custody Orders.
The guardian can be paid from the wards money for the guardianship work, but only with a written court order.
Every year, a Guardian of an adult, and a guardian who is not related to his or her minor ward, must file an Annual Report stating the condition of the ward, whether the Guardianship should continue, how he or she cared for the ward during the last year, and what the plans are to care for the ward for the next year.
